Wheels and tyres
WHEELS AND TYRES
Specification Desc./Quantity
Front wheel rim Die-cast aluminium alloy; 3.50 x 12"
Front tyre Tubeless 120/70-12"
Rear wheel rim Die-cast aluminium alloy: 3.00"x12"
Rear tyre Tubeless 120/70 - 12"
Front tyre pressure 1.8 bar
Rear tyre pressure 2 bar
Rear wheel pressure (rider and passenger): 2.3 bar
Secondary air
In order to reduce polluting emissions, the vehicle
is furnished with a catalytic converter in the muf-
fler.
To favour the catalytic process, an extra amount
of oxygen is added via a secondary air system
(SAS).
This system allows more oxygen to be added to
the unburned gases before they reach the con-
verter, thus improving the action of the catalytic
converter.
The air enters the exhaust duct from the head, and
is purified by a black filter.
The system is fitted with a control valve that disa-
bles operation while decelerating to avoid unwan-
ted noise.
To ensure the best functioning of the SAS system,
every 12,000 km the scooter should be taken to an
Authorised Piaggio Service Centre to have the
filter cleaned (Scheduled maintenance operations
section).
The filter sponge should be cleaned with water and
mild soap, then it should be dried with a cloth and
slight blows of compressed air.
